Hi, I have an iMac 2.8 GHz intel Core 2 Duo, 2GB 800 MHz SDRAM, OSX 10.5.8, TeXShop 2.36, and R 2.11.1. I have all the Sweave files in the TeXShop ~/Engines folder. It has been six or seven months since I last tried to compile a Rnw file in TeXShop and now I get the following error: /Users/keithjones/Library/TeXShop/Engines/Sweave.engine does not have the executable bit set. It worked fine the last time I used it. Has something changed in the OS? How do I set the executable bit?
